In this paper, we present an online ascent phase trajectory reconstruction algorithm using Gauss Pseudospectral *** Pseudospectral Method (GPM) was used to transform the ascent phase trajectory optimization problem into Nonlinear Program Problem (NLP), we solve the problem using a optimization software named GPOPS in *** this method we can calculate the optimal trajectory control volume and feedback to update the guidance commands *** analysis of the optimized results has been done to prove its *** last, we compare the trajectory recon- struction algorithm to a law without reconstruction algorithm via simulation with aerodynamic and thrust *** simulation results indicate that the method proposed above offers improved performance and has ability for real-time calculating.

In this paper, an optimal guidance algorithm is proposed for atmospheric *** optimal guidance algorithm updates the reference trajectory to deal with the impact of disturbance by solving an optimal control problem *** the strong nonlinear ascent dynamic, the optimal control problem is transformed into nonlinear programming problem by trajectory *** direct optimization method is implemented for this nonlinear programming *** a segment of the reference trajectory is updated by the optimal guidance *** to the small amount of the discrete nodes and the initial guess solution which is close to the optimization solution, the direct optimization method is fast enough to generate a new reference *** simulation for the Generic Hypersonic Vehicle model and scramjet engine is done for different cases of the aerodynamic coefficient *** results show the accuracy and the effectiveness of this optimal guidance algorithm.

A new model-based human body tracking framework with learning-based theory is introduced in this *** propose a variable structure multiple model (VSMM) framework to address challenging problems such as uncertainty of motion styles,imprecise detection of feature points,and ambiguity of joint *** human joint points are detected automatically and the undetected points are estimated with Kalman *** motion models are learned from motion capture data using a ridge regression *** model set that covers the total motion set is designed on the basis of topological and compatibility relationships,while the VSMM algorithm is used to estimate quaternion vectors of joint *** using real image sequences and simulation videos demonstrate the high efficiency of our proposed human tracking framework.

Visual servoing has been around for decades, but the time delay is still one of the most troublesome problems to achieve maneuvering target *** circumvent the problem, in this paper, the Kalman filter is employed to estimate future position of the maneuvering *** order to introduce the Kalman filter, the accurate time delays, which include the processing lag and the motion lag, need to be ***, the delays of the visual control servoing systems are discussed, and a generic timing model for the system are ***, we present a current statistical model for maneuvering *** adaptive Kalman filter, which is evolved from the Kalman filter, is put forward based on the current statistical *** results show that the modified adaptive filter can improve the ability of maneuvering target tracking.
